In Distinction To absolutely disclosed broker-dealers, omnibus broker-dealers don’t disclose individual customer details to the clearing agency. Instead, the broker-dealer manages all buyer transactions internally and is liable for reconciling these transactions throughout the omnibus account.

Liquidity dangers can result in monetary losses, operational disruptions, and reputational damage. To mitigate liquidity dangers https://www.xcritical.com/, broker-dealers should keep adequate liquidity buffers, monitor their funding and collateral positions, and set up contingency plans for potential liquidity occasions. Clearing and settlement contain dealing with counterparties, which can expose broker-dealers to counterparty danger. Counterparty risk refers again to the risk that a counterparty will default on its obligations, leading to financial losses or operational disruptions for the broker-dealer. This threat could be mitigated by performing due diligence on counterparties, monitoring their creditworthiness, and implementing risk administration strategies corresponding to collateralization and netting.
